2008 FERRARI 430 SCUDERIA - LHD

Finished in Rosso Scuderia with NART racing stripe, Oro wheels and Tessuto Rosso interior, this 2008 Ferrari 430 Scuderia is a sensational road car presented in superb condition. It is powered by a sonorous 4.3-litre flat-plane crank V8 engine producing 503bhp, driving the rear wheels via the six-speed ‘F1-SuperFast 2’ automated manual with paddle shift. This left-hand-drive example has covered 25,337 km (15,744 miles) from new.

Replacing the Challenge Stradale, the 430 Scuderia was launched to a wave of five-star reviews. CAR Magazine called it “quite simply the best road-legal, track-friendly supercar on sale today”, while Autocar stated: “F1 technology turns the F430 into one of the most exciting road cars we've ever driven”.

Originally delivered to Switzerland, this Scuderia was first registered on 4 March 2008 before being imported to the UK in June 2014. The car has had five previous owners, though there are two previous keepers on the V5C log book. The seller acquired it just over four years ago, and has enjoyed some 7,200 km behind the wheel since then.

The Rosso Scuderia paintwork is in excellent condition, with just some minor stone chips to the bonnet and front wings. The seller notes that the front bumper has previously been repainted, most likely to rectify earlier stone chips. As a Scuderia model, the car boasts carbon-fibre trim for the rear panel and wing mirrors, all of which is in superb order, and the gold 19-inch forged Scuderia wheels are in very good condition – with the exception of a small 3mm chip on one rear wheel. The Brembo brake calipers around the carbon-ceramic brake discs also present very well.

The interior is focused and continues the lightweight theme, featuring carbon-fibre bucket seats trimmed in a combination of Alcantara with Tessuto Rosso ‘3D’ technical cloth centre panels. All of the trim is in excellent condition, as you would expect in a low-mileage car, with only slight wear to the driver’s seat bolster. The first owner also opted for a fittingly pure specification without a radio. All of the switchgear and electrics work perfectly.

Over the last six years in particular, the car has received comprehensive maintenance at Ferrari main dealers and specialists. In March 2020, the car received new front lower ball joints, rear tie rod ends and lower rear shock absorber bushes by AV Engineering in Kent. Shortly afterwards, it had a full four-wheel alignment carried out at Dick Lovett Ferrari in Swindon.

Its last full service was at 25,019 km in October 2019, carried out by Dick Lovett. This two-year service included new engine oil and filter, new brake fluid, and replacement of the power steering fluid and gearbox oil. The two previous services were also at Dick Lovett, in May 2018 at 22,736 km, and in June 2017 at 21,236 km; the latter also including renewal of the auxiliary belts. In October 2019, the clutch wear reading was recorded at 28.8%, while the carbon-ceramic disc wear was at 19% - and the car has covered less than 400 km since then.

The last MOT test was on 19 June 2020 at 25,337 km, which resulted in a clean pass with no advisories. Four new Pirelli P Zero Corsa tyres were fitted on 1 June 2020, and so are in as-new condition. Accompanying the car are all of the original books, a sales brochure, two keys, and the original tool kit and gloves.

This Ferrari 430 Scuderia is an excellent example of a highly focused limited-run road car, which boasts a wonderfully analogue driving experience when compared to many of the latest supercars. With low mileage and comprehensive recent maintenance history, this is a superb Ferrari that would be a great addition to any collection.
